Key Specifications Breakdown

  • Caliber: 9mm Luger (9x19mm).
  • Capacity: 17+1 rounds (includes five magazines).
  • Barrel Length: 5.2 inches.
  • Overall Length: 8.7 inches.
  • Weight: Approximately 33.3 ounces (unloaded).
  • Finish: Black slide with an anodized Flat Dark Earth (FDE) aluminum frame.
  • Sights: Low-profile, dovetailed front and rear with three white dots; rear sight is adjustable for windage.
  • Grip: Vertec-style thin profile with replaceable backstraps for hand size customization.
  • Action: Type G (decocker-only, no manual safety lever). Double-action/single-action trigger.
  • Frame Material: Aluminum alloy, anodized in Flat Dark Earth.
  • Slide Material: Steel with a Bruniton black finish.
  • Accessory Rail: Picatinny-style MIL-STD-1913 rail for lights or lasers.
  • Magazine Release: Ambidextrous, reversible for left-handed shooters.
  • Safety Features: Firing pin block, trigger bar disconnect, and decocker.

Feature Deep-Dive

The Beretta M9A3 distinguishes itself from earlier M9 variants through several practical refinements. The Type G configuration removes the manual safety lever found on standard M9s, replacing it with a decocker-only mechanism. This simplifies operation for shooters who prefer a consistent trigger pull from the holster, as the decocker safely lowers the hammer without requiring a manual safety to be engaged or disengaged. This design is well-regarded among those who train for defensive or competitive use where every action must be deliberate and efficient.

The Vertec-style grip is a notable upgrade for shooters with smaller hands or those who prefer a more vertical grip angle. The thin profile reduces the distance from the backstrap to the trigger, making it easier to reach the double-action trigger pull without altering grip position. The inclusion of replaceable backstraps allows further customization, accommodating hand sizes from slim to broad. This attention to ergonomics helps maintain consistent sight alignment during rapid strings of fire, a benefit for both new shooters and experienced marksmen.

The 5.2-inch barrel provides a longer sight radius compared to compact or subcompact pistols, which can improve shot placement at distances beyond 25 yards. The barrel is cold-hammer-forged and features a recessed crown for protection against damage. This barrel length also contributes to higher muzzle velocity with standard 9mm loads, though the difference is modest compared to shorter barrels. The full-length recoil spring and guide rod system reduce felt recoil and help the pistol return to zero more quickly, supporting follow-up shot accuracy.

The Flat Dark Earth anodized frame is not merely cosmetic; the anodizing process creates a hard, corrosion-resistant surface that stands up to holster wear and exposure to moisture. The black Bruniton finish on the slide offers similar protection against rust and scratches. This combination of finishes is practical for users who carry the pistol in varied environments, from humid ranges to dusty outdoor settings. The Picatinny rail on the frame provides a standardized mounting point for lights or lasers, making the M9A3 adaptable for low-light home defense scenarios.

Included with the pistol are five 17-round magazines, each with a steel body and polymer base pad. This quantity reduces the need to purchase additional magazines for training or reload drills. The magazines are compatible with standard Beretta 92/M9 series pistols, though the M9A3’s magwell is slightly beveled for faster reloads. The magazine release is ambidextrous and can be reversed for left-handed operation without tools, a feature appreciated by left-handed shooters who often struggle with standard controls.

The trigger system offers a double-action first pull of approximately 12 pounds, followed by single-action pulls of roughly 5.5 pounds. This is a common setup for service pistols, providing a heavier initial pull for safety during reholstering and a lighter pull for subsequent shots. The trigger reset is tactile and audible, aiding in rapid firing sequences. While not a competition trigger, it is predictable and reliable, with a smooth take-up that most shooters find manageable after a brief familiarization period.

Ideal Use Cases

  • Home Defense: The full-size frame and 17-round capacity provide a stable platform for accurate fire under stress. The Picatinny rail allows for attachment of a weapon-mounted light, which is critical for identifying threats in low-light conditions. The decocker-only safety reduces the risk of inadvertently engaging a manual safety during a defensive encounter.
  • Range Training and Target Shooting: The longer barrel and heavier weight help manage recoil, making it easier to maintain sight picture during extended sessions. The five included magazines reduce downtime for reloading, allowing for more efficient practice. The adjustable rear sight enables zeroing for different ammunition types.
  • Competition (USPSA, IDPA): While not a dedicated race gun, the M9A3 is legal in Production and Limited divisions in USPSA and SSP division in IDPA. The 17-round capacity is competitive, and the Vertec grip aids in quick target transitions. The double-action first shot is a requirement in certain divisions, making this pistol a viable entry-level option.
  • Duty or Open Carry: Law enforcement or security personnel who prefer a full-size 9mm with a decocker will find the M9A3 suitable. The durable finishes and ambidextrous controls support both left- and right-handed users. The weight and size are typical for duty holsters.
  • Collecting: The M9A3 represents a modern iteration of the M9 platform, with design cues from the military’s M9A1 and input from special operations units. For collectors of Beretta or military-style firearms, this model is a notable addition due to its specific feature set and limited production runs compared to standard 92 series pistols.

Compatibility Notes

  • Ammunition: This pistol is designed for 9mm Luger ammunition (9x19mm). It functions reliably with standard pressure and +P loads, though +P+ ammunition is not recommended due to increased wear. Use brass-cased, jacketed, or lead round nose ammunition for best reliability. Avoid aluminum-cased or steel-cased ammunition in high volume, as extractor wear may increase.
  • Holsters: The M9A3 fits holsters designed for the Beretta 92 series with a Picatinny rail, such as those made by Safariland, Blackhawk, and Alien Gear. Note that the Vertec grip may cause a slightly tighter fit in some holsters designed for standard 92 grips. Test retention before use.
  • Magazines: The included 17-round magazines are compatible with all Beretta 92, 96, and M9 series pistols. Aftermarket magazines from Mec-Gar and ProMag are also available, though Mec-Gar is recommended for reliability. The M9A3 does not accept 92 Compact or 92X magazines without modification due to grip length differences.
  • Accessories: The Picatinny rail accepts most standard weapon lights and lasers, including Streamlight TLR-1, SureFire X300, and Crimson Trace Rail Master. The dovetailed sights can be replaced with aftermarket night sights or fiber optic options from Trijicon, Dawson Precision, or Ameriglo. The barrel is not threaded; threaded barrel models are available separately if a suppressor is desired.
  • Parts and Upgrades: Replacement springs, guide rods, and recoil buffers are widely available from Wolff Gunsprings and other manufacturers. Trigger upgrades, such as the Beretta D-spring or aftermarket trigger bars, can reduce trigger pull weight if desired. Most internal parts are interchangeable with standard 92 series components.

Q: Is this pistol compatible with +P and +P+ ammunition?
A: This pistol is rated for +P ammunition (higher pressure than standard 9mm) and will function reliably with it. +P+ ammunition is not recommended as it exceeds SAAMI pressure specifications and can accelerate wear on the barrel, slide, and recoil spring. For routine training and target use, standard pressure 9mm ammunition is sufficient and will extend the service life of the firearm. Always consult the owner’s manual for specific ammunition guidelines.
